rdesktop is an open source client for Windows NT Terminal Server and
Windows 2000 Terminal Services, capable of natively speaking Remote
Desktop Protocol (RDP) in order to present the user's NT desktop.
Unlike Citrix ICA, no server extensions are required.

Chromium is a system for interactive rendering on clusters of graphics workstations. Various parallel rendering techniques such as sort-first and sort-last may be implemented with Chromium. Furthermore, Chromium allows filtering and manipulation of OpenGL command streams for non-invasive rendering algorithms.

Mesa is a 3-D graphics library with an API which is very similar to
that of OpenGL.* To the extent that Mesa utilizes the OpenGL command
syntax or state machine, it is being used with authorization from
Silicon Graphics, Inc.(SGI). However, the author does not possess an
OpenGL license from SGI, and makes no claim that Mesa is in any way a
compatible replacement for OpenGL or associated with SGI. Those who
want a licensed implementation of OpenGL should contact a licensed
vendor.

Please do not refer to the library as MesaGL (for legal reasons). It's
just Mesa or The Mesa 3-D graphics library.

* OpenGL is a trademark of Silicon Graphics Incorporated.

Compiz is an OpenGL compositing manager that use
GLX_EXT_texture_from_drawable for binding redirected top-level windows
to texture objects. It has a flexible plug-in system and it is designed
to run well on most graphics hardware.

This package contains Compiz-Fusion community extra plugins.

Contains: addhelper crashhandler extrawm firepaint goto-viewport
mswitch scalefilter splash bench cubereflex fadedesktop gears group
mblur reflex showdesktop trailfocus.

This package contains Compiz-Fusion community main plugins.

Contains: animation expo ezoom jpeg neg opacify put resizeinfo ring
scaleaddon snap text thumbnail vpswitch wall winrules workarounds.
